In the digital economy era, digitalization and intelligent technologies have profoundly influenced regional green development. This study uses data from 277 prefecture-level and above cities in China spanning the years 2011 to 2022 and employs a two-way fixed effects model along with machine learning techniques to explore the effect of digital intelligence on regional green development. We find that digital intelligence primarily drives regional green development.
